Human touch and AI tools play different but complementary roles in social media marketing. Each has its unique strengths and limitations, and understanding their importance can help businesses create effective and engaging social media strategies.
Importance of Human Touch in Social Media Marketing:
- Creativity and Emotional Connection: Humans excel at creativity and emotional intelligence. They can craft compelling and personalized content that resonates with the target audience, creating a strong emotional connection and fostering brand loyalty.
- Authenticity and Empathy: People appreciate genuine interactions. Human social media managers can respond to comments, messages, and feedback with empathy, making customers feel valued and heard, leading to positive brand perception.
- Real-time Adaptation: Social media platforms can be dynamic, and real-time adaptation is crucial. Human managers can quickly adjust strategies based on emerging trends, news, or customer sentiments, ensuring the brand remains relevant and responsive.
- Relationship Building: Social media provides an opportunity to build meaningful relationships with customers. Human managers can engage in conversations, answer questions, and provide personalized support, strengthening brand-customer relationships.
- Community Management: Nurturing online communities requires understanding and responsiveness. Humans can moderate discussions, maintain a positive environment, and identify potential issues or opportunities within the community.
Importance of AI Tools in Social Media Marketing:
- Data Analysis and Insights: AI tools can process vast amounts of data from social media platforms and other sources, providing valuable insights into customer behavior, preferences, and trends. This data-driven approach helps refine marketing strategies.
- Automation and Efficiency: AI tools can automate routine tasks, such as scheduling posts, replying to common queries, and tracking key performance metrics. This frees up human marketers to focus on more strategic and creative aspects of the campaign.
- Personalization at Scale: AI can analyze individual customer data and behaviors to deliver personalized content and recommendations, even in large and diverse audiences, enhancing the user experience and increasing engagement.
- Sentiment Analysis: AI-powered sentiment analysis can monitor online conversations to gauge public opinion and track brand reputation. This helps companies respond to potential crises and manage brand sentiment effectively.
- Ad Targeting and Optimization: AI algorithms can optimize social media ad campaigns by identifying the most relevant audience segments and refining targeting parameters, leading to better ad performance and cost-effectiveness.
In summary, human touch brings authenticity, creativity, empathy, and relationship building to social media marketing. On the other hand, AI tools offer efficiency, data-driven insights, personalization at scale, sentiment analysis, and optimization. A successful social media marketing strategy involves leveraging the strengths of both human and AI elements, striking a balance between human-led creativity and data-driven decision-making.
